I really enjoy Ci Ci's pizza. I'm stunned that such an inexpensive meal can taste so good. There's something about the sauce, I think... it's just great! I find myself craving the stuff pretty frequently.
However, I recommend getting carry-out or dining in during a period when the restaurant isn't as busy (mid-afternoon is usually better). The dining area itself is pretty small, and the acoustics aren't so great. Many people like to bring in their kids, schools bring groups, TV's are always on, staff are usually talkative, and folks are always moving about, so this makes for quite a noisy atmosphere.
The good thing about dining in, though, is that the friendly staff will add any pizza to the buffet that you request. I've never had a problem getting what I want to eat. I highly recommend the cheesy garlic bread and don't forget the cinnamon rolls as a dessert - both are very yummy!
